Dominated splitting from constant periodic data and global rigidity of Anosov automorphisms

Abstract

We show that a GL(d,R)\mathrm{GL}(d,\mathbb{R}) cocycle over a hyperbolic system with constant periodic data has a dominated splitting whenever the periodic data indicates it should. This implies global periodic data rigidity of generic Anosov automorphisms of Td\mathbb{T}^d. Further, our approach also works when the periodic data is narrow, that is, sufficiently close to constant. We can show global periodic data rigidity for certain non-linear Anosov diffeomorphisms in a neighborhood of an irreducible Anosov automorphism with simple spectrum.
